Pass up - The pass was for the Explorer tours. There is a hop-on hop off bus for the city centre, but there are dedicated bus tours for the Beatles (strawberry fields) and the Liverpool FC (anfield). Don't buy this ticket if you want to go out to Anfield Liverpool FC, as it was not running when I was there. Also, the Strawberry Fields is just a short stop on the Beatles tour which only happens twice a day, so no time to go in and enjoy that portion of the tour. So if that appeals to you, you should get a taxi to go out there and back. I did the Beatles Story and the British Music experience, and the Mersey ferry tour as well as the hop-on hop off bus tour and the Beatles bus tour. There is a separate Beatles Mystery Tour, not covered by this pass, that seemed a better way to see the beatles places. If I had to do it over again, I would get the other hop-on hop-off tour, the mystery tour, and do the beatles story . I also enjoyed the free museums in Liverpool which are great.
